DAVID K David K has submitted songs to multiple rock stars and legends such as Randy Meisner of The Eagles, Edgar Winter, Toni Braxton, Rick Danko of The Band and members of James Brown’s band, as well as Jeff Cook of 80s legendary country band, Alabama. David has performed with Jeff Cook, with Fergie Frederiksen of Toto, with Dr. (Matt) Fink of Prince & The Revolution, and has recorded with Joey Molland of Badfinger — original members of The Beatles Apple Records label, and with Phil Solem co-writer of “I’ll Be There For You,” the Friends TV show theme, member of The Rembrandts. Phil played bass on 5 tracks of David’s recent album, “Big News Cafe.” David has met and interviewed countless rock stars for his magazine and for a TV show he’s spent years developing and pitching to national networks. David has been in contention to be on a network songwriter reality shows. He has also worked with major global corporations in musical promotions with Coca-Cola.
